3 The people of Israel cried out to Yahweh for help. King Jabin had 900 chariots made of iron and had cruelly oppressed Israel for 20 years.
4 Deborah, wife of Lappidoth, was a prophet. She was the judge in Israel at that time. 5 She used to sit under the Palm Tree of Deborah between Ramah and Bethel in the mountains of Ephraim. The people of Israel would come to her for legal decisions.

3 Because he had nine hundred chariots fitted with iron(A) and had cruelly oppressed(B) the Israelites for twenty years, they cried to the Lord for help.
4 Now Deborah,(C) a prophet,(D) the wife of Lappidoth, was leading[a] Israel at that time. 5 She held court(E) under the Palm of Deborah between Ramah(F) and Bethel(G) in the hill country of Ephraim, and the Israelites went up to her to have their disputes decided.
